Does that make sense to you? > > > > Thanks, > > Alireza > > > > > > On Sun, Dec 15, 2019 at 7:19 AM dormando <dorma...@rydia.net> wrote: > > What version of memcached is on each machine? > > > > memcached doesn't use processes, it's multi-threaded. Different > versions > > may have a different number of background threads. In the > latest version > > there should be at least: > > > > - listener thread (main "process") > > - N worker threads > > - hash table maintenance thread > > - async log thread (for `watch` commands) > > - LRU maintainer thread > > - LRU crawler thread > > - slab rebalancer thread > > > > they're all idle unless they need to do work. LRU maintenance > thread is > > probably the most active, since it executes LRU maintenance > work deferred > > from the worker threads. Older versions have some of these > threads, but > > they were not enabled by default until 1.5.0. > > > > -Dormando > > > > On Sat, 14 Dec 2019, Alireza Sanaee wrote: > > > > > Hello, > > > I'm running Memcached on two different machines with > different specifications.
